We have an angel care monitor, that we got when Zach was a baby, with the detachable portion of motion detector to put under the crib mattress - it was great, because an alarm would start going off (loud too!) if ever the baby stopped breathing for longer than 15 seconds. Too many times we took the baby our of the crib and forgot to turn off the monitor... makes you jump!
